'Grand Theft Auto 5' update: Details to be released by Rockstar?

Rumor has it that a new update is coming to "Grand Theft Auto V" this June. YouTube/Rockstar Games

Rockstar Games is once again on a roll, as a new update is slated to arrive to "Grand Theft Auto V" very soon. Although everything about it remains vague, the studio is said to introduce tons of interesting features. But for now, the company has opted to give players a handful of bonuses.

According to Express, a release date for the aforementioned "Grand Theft Auto V" update is unknown. However, there are talks about the studio unveiling the specifics in the next few days. That is because they are believed to be unveiling a huge announcement.

As of this writing, Rockstar has resorted to releasing a good number of bonuses for players to enjoy. These discounts and bonuses are spendable on a Clubhouse and everything that concerns it. The release date of these bonuses interestingly reveals the studio's plans for releasing the above-mentioned update.

It is worth noting that in the past, the video game company has been known for releasing various bonuses and discounts. Surprisingly, when they do so, a new update is always on its way. This can be likened to the bonuses they gave out late last year, which was immediately followed by an update. So, in a sense, the studio might be doing exactly what they did previously.

There are also rumors that the next "Grand Theft Auto V" update is actually the highly anticipated Gun Runner update. Since day one, this has been the center of discussions within the community. If these speculations prove to be true, then the update could arrive sometime in June.

Meanwhile, GTA 5 Cheats reports that the highest in-game amount to be given in the current bonus gig is around $250K. In fact, there are "Grand Theft Auto V" players who have been receiving these bonuses multiple times already. But while there are those who are lucky enough, some have just pure bad luck.
